As readers of our site may be aware, Halloween has become an increasingly big event in Japan in recent years. And this trick-or-treat season, Starbucks Japan has apparently decided to add to the excitement with a limited-edition Halloween drink that will be available for just seven days. The catch is, they’re not announcing what flavor the drink is.
That’s right, Starbucks Japan is now serving a Halloween Frappuccino drink, but they’re purposely not advertising the flavor of the drink, calling it the Halloween Mystery Frappuccino. Naturally, we just had to find out what the mystery flavor is, so we headed to a Starbucks to order the special drink the day it was released!
